NIFL-Technology Colleagues,

I have just updated the Harnessing Technology Web page (Harnessing
Technology to Serve Adult Literacy), and it has several new sections.
It now includes a GED Resources section, which has been enriched by
several contributors on the NIFL-Technology list.  

The purpose of this Web page is to provide technology solutions to common,
everyday problems in the adult basic education/ESOL classroom.  Most of
the problems and solutions have been contributed by teachers and other
practitioners. The page is intended to provide good answers to teachers
who are sceptical about the value of using technology in an adult basic
education/ESOL learning environment.

You will find the Harnessing Technology Web Page in its new location at: 

			alri.org/integratech.html

I hope you will have a look, and also consider contributing a problem and
solution, or a solution to a problem already posed which uses technology.
Those who contribute are given, as an incentive,  a different Web page
address which is updated more frequently.
